FREE FRIDAY FUNNIES: COMEDY FEST COMES TO TAKUTAI SQUARE ON FRIDAY 10 APRIL
The New Zealand Comedy Trust & Britomart present
Comedy Fest in Takutai Square
NZ International Comedy Festival with Best Foods Mayo is teaming up with Britomartto bring the laughs with Comedy Fest in Takutai Square, a free day of comedy that promises a sneak peek of what’s to come at this year’s NZ Comedy Fest, on Friday 10 April.
Fresh faces and top-tier talent from the expansive Aotearoa comedy scene will take over Takutai Square to serve up their funniest gags and silliest bits, all for free. Whether you want to pop down during your lunch break, you’ve got tamariki to keep entertained during the school holidays, or you’re meeting friends after work, the Fest has you covered.
At 12.30PM, Lunchtime Laughs is a pick-me-up guaranteed to have you in stitches over your sandwich. The relatable and always crack-up Tony Lyall (7 Days, Comedy Gala, The Project) hosts a stellar line-up, featuring Raw National Comedy Quest finalists Annie Guo,Evie Orpe and Sophie Stone, The Lord of the Rings: The Rings of Power star Anthony Crum, and The Edge host-turned-comedian Harrison Keefe.
Laughter is for everyone! Family-Friendly Funnies at 3PM sees Sam Smith (the comedian not the singer; our Sam Smith has been on 7 Days and Taskmaster) host a whānau-focused lineup of comedians and improvisors. Clowning their way through an hour of school holiday entertainment are Florence Hartigan (Me, My Mother and Suzy Cato) and Auckland’s improv favourites Bull Rush.
When the sun goes down, the legends come out for Later On Laughs. From 6.30PM, 2025 Billy T nominee Itay Dom (Guy Mont-Spelling Bee, The Bachelorette NZ) hosts an unmissable who’s-who of comedy in Aotearoa including Celebrity Treasure Island runner-up Courtney Dawson (NZICF Best Newcomer 2024), 7 Days regular Paul Douglas, 2023 Billy T nominee Gabby Anderson and New Zealand’s favourite American country singer and comedy legend, Wilson Dixon.
“We are stoked to debut a free day of comedy at Takutai Square. A massive mihi to Britomart for helping us to bring more laughs into the inner-city at a time when Aucklanders really need it! Keeping the event free makes it super easy for people to meet up and discover a new favourite comedian ahead of the NZ International Comedy Festival in May,” says Festival Producer Jay Law.
Comedy Fest in Takutai Square is a partnership between NZ Comedy Trust and Britomart, proudly supported by Auckland Council Events and the City Centre Targeted Rate.
The 2026 NZ International Comedy Festival with Best Foods Mayo runs from 1 – 24 May.
